I make extra light syrup with 3/4 cups sugar and 6 1/2 cups water (for a 9-pint canner load), or 1 1/4 cups sugar to 10 1/2 cups water (for a 7-quart canner load). For sweeter grapes, try light syrup or even medium syrup, but know that the grapes will be more like candied grapes than canned fresh fruit.

Steps: Combine all ingredients except grapes in a small saucepan and boil for two to three minutes. Pierce each grape two to three times with a sharp skewer or toothpick. Place grapes in a small bowl and cover with the syrup mixture. Refrigerate for 24 to 36 hours. Serve with cheese or nuts.

Preparation. Put the sugar and spices in the Mason jar. Add the vodka, close the lid and shake gently until sugar is dissolved. Fill the Mason jar up with grapes to fit snug. Add more vodka if the top grapes are not submerged. Fasten the lid tight. Gently tip the Mason jar a couple of times to settle the grapes in the vodka.

Instructions. Slip the skins off the grapes and set aside for now. Transfer the grape insides to a heavy-bottomed, lidded 5-quart pot. Cover the pot, bring to a simmer over medium heat, and simmer 10 minutes. Turn heat off and cool to room temperature (this will take up to a couple hours).
